When the terminal side of an angle intersects the unit circle at point (x, y), then: The x-coordinate corresponds to the cosine of the angle formed with the positive x-axis and the terminal side, while the y-coordinate corresponds to the sine of that angle. Depending on the signs of x and y coordinates, we can determine the quadrant in which the angle resides.

Let the train's speed be denoted as x km/h.
Scenario 1:
Distance = 288 km
Speed = x km/h
Time = Distance divided by Speed
= 288/x hours
Scenario 2:
Distance = 288 km
Speed = (x + 4) km/h
Time = 288/(x + 4) hours
As 288/x is greater than 288/(x + 4)
288/x - 288/(x + 4) = 1
288[1/x - 1/(x + 4)] = 1
[x + 4 - x] / [x(x + 4)] = 1/288
[4 / (x^2 + 4x)] = 1/288
x² + 4x = 1152
x² + 4x - 1152 = 0
x² + 36x - 32x - 1152 = 0
x(x + 36) - 32(x + 36) = 0
(x + 36)(x - 32) = 0
x + 36 = 0, x - 32 = 0
x = -36, x = 32
x = -36 is not valid as speed cannot be negative.
Conclusively, the train's speed = 32 km/h

When combining two fractions that each exceeds 1/2, their sum will invariably exceed 1.
Detailed breakdown: 1/2 + 1/2 = 1
Since both fractions exceed this amount, it is evident that the sum must as well.
Examples: 2/3+3/4= 1 5/12 4/6+6/9= 1 1/3
